Understanding the Role of an Accident Injury Lawyer
An accident injury lawyer is a legal professional who specializes in tort law-- specifically, civil wrongs or injuries arising from negligence. Their main goal is to advocate for the injured celebration (the plaintiff) and secure financial compensation from the responsible celebration (the offender) or their insurance coverage business.

The Personal Injury Claims Process: What to Expect
Browsing an individual Injury Compensation Lawyer claim can seem like finding out a foreign language. Understanding the general phases of a Claim For Accident can assist demystify the process.
StageDescriptionCommon Duration1. Initial ConsultationThe victim consults with a lawyer to talk about the accident, injuries, and potential legal options. Free of charge in most cases.1 Hour2. Examination & & Medical TreatmentThe lawyer constructs the case by collecting evidence while the client focuses on reaching Maximum Medical Improvement (MMI).Weeks to Months3. Need LetterThe lawyer sends out a detailed demand bundle detailing the injuries and requested payment to the insurance provider.1 - 2 Weeks4. SettlementBack-and-forth discussions in between the lawyer and insurance adjusters to reach a mutually appropriate settlement.Weeks to Months5. Filing a LawsuitIf negotiations fail, an official problem is filed in civil court, initiating the litigation stage.Varies6. DiscoveryBoth sides exchange details, depose witnesses, and collect further proof before trial.6 Months to 1 Year7. TrialIf no settlement is reached during mediation, the case goes before a judge and jury for a final decision.Numerous Days to WeeksHow Accident Compensation is Calculated

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Just how much does it cost to employ an accident injury lawyer?
A lot of accident injury attorneys operate on a contingency charge basis. This indicates you pay absolutely nothing in advance. Rather, the lawyer takes an agreed-upon portion (typically in between 33% and 40%) of the final settlement or court award. If they do not recuperate money for you, you owe them absolutely nothing for their legal fees.
2. For how long do I need to file an injury suit?
Every state has a strict due date understood as the statute of constraints. Depending upon the jurisdiction and the type of accident, this window is generally in between one and 3 years from the date of the accident. Waiting too long to consult a lawyer can completely bar you from looking for settlement.

4. Will my case go to trial?
Statistically, the vast majority of injury cases (roughly 90-95%) are settled out of court through settlement or mediation. Nevertheless, having a lawyer who is completely prepared to take your case to trial provides you substantial utilize throughout settlement negotiations.
5. What if I was partly at fault for the accident?
Depending on your state's laws, you may still have the ability to recover compensation. Numerous states follow comparative carelessness rules, which permit you to recuperate damages even if you share some blame, though your overall payment may be minimized by your percentage of fault. A skilled lawyer can help protect your rights under these complex state-specific laws.
